Departure and Pickup Details

The tour departs from the Grand Canyon Scenic Airlines Terminal in Boulder City, Nevada, located approximately 30 minutes from the bustling city of Las Vegas. We offer hotel pickup and drop-off services from select hotels along the Las Vegas Strip and in Downtown, ensuring a seamless start and end to your aerial adventure.
To get the most out of your experience, we recommend:
- Arriving 45 minutes prior to your scheduled departure time for check-in.
- Informing us if you’re traveling with an infant under 2 years old, as they can sit on your lap.
- Letting us know if any passengers weigh over 300 lbs, as they’ll need to purchase an additional seat.
- Reviewing our cancellation policy, as tours may be cancelled due to inclement weather.

Tour Inclusions

Included in the Grand Canyon West Helicopter Tour from Las Vegas is a 35-minute (approximately) helicopter flight each way from Boulder City. Plus, we provide hotel pickup and drop-off, as well as a hop-on/hop-off shuttle to Eagle Point and Guano Point.
Should you choose to upgrade, General Admission to the Skywalk is also included.

Cancellation Policy

Full refunds are provided if the tour is cancelled at least 24 hours before the experience’s start time. However, no refunds are offered for cancellations made less than 24 hours prior to the tour’s commencement.
Plus, the tour may be cancelled due to poor weather conditions, in which case a different date or a full refund will be offered.

Optional Skywalk Visit

For those who want to experience the thrill of walking on air, the Skywalk is an optional add-on to the Grand Canyon West Helicopter Tour.
This transparent horseshoe-shaped glass bridge extends 70 feet out from the rim of the Grand Canyon, providing unparalleled views of the canyon’s vast expanse and the Colorado River 4,000 feet below.
While not included in the base tour, we can upgrade to include the Skywalk, allowing us to venture out on this engineering marvel for an unforgettable perspective.
The Skywalk is located at Eagle Point, one of the tour’s hop-on/hop-off stops, giving us the flexibility to spend as much time as we’d like taking in this unique experience.
